Stopping GLP-1 Medicine Can Rapidly Erase Main Coronary heart Advantages

One in 8 American adults now takes a GLP-1 drug to handle diabetes or weight problems. Whereas each medical and real-world outcomes have proven these drugs can enhance coronary heart well being, new analysis has discovered a draw back: Individuals who cease taking them shortly lose these enhancements and could also be at an elevated danger of coronary heart assault, stroke, and even loss of life in contrast with individuals who keep on them persistently.

“When individuals are on these drugs, all these useful issues occur: Blood strain will get higher, ldl cholesterol goes down, insulin resistance goes down,” says the senior research creator, Ziyad Al-Aly, MD, a medical epidemiologist at WashU Drugs and the chief of the analysis and improvement service on the VA Saint Louis Well being Care System, each in Missouri.

“Once they cease taking the medicine, they’re exposing their physique to whiplash that stresses the guts and undoes numerous these cardiovascular advantages,” Dr. Al-Aly says.

Right here’s what the research discovered, plus what medical doctors need folks with a historical past of coronary heart well being points to bear in mind earlier than beginning certainly one of these drugs.

Pausing GLP-1 Remedy Led to Penalties

The research, printed within the journal BMJ Drugs, adopted greater than 333,000 American veterans with kind 2 diabetes for 3 years. All have been taking certainly one of two diabetes medicine sorts: both a GLP-1 or a sulfonylurea, a category of medicine that stimulate the pancreas to launch extra insulin.

Individuals who stayed on their GLP-1 medicine repeatedly had an 82 p.c decrease danger of cardiovascular occasions like coronary heart assault, stroke, or loss of life in the course of the three-year research interval than those that took a sulfonylurea.

However those that stopped or paused GLP-1s for six months had a big enhance in danger of main cardiovascular occasions.

Additionally they had a 4 p.c greater danger of cardiovascular points than these frequently on a sulfonylurea. That danger differential elevated to 14 p.c a 12 months after they stopped a GLP-1, and rose to as a lot as 22 p.c after two years off the medicine.

“Even transient intervals of discontinuations or interruptions may progressively erode and will finally reverse this safety, growing the chance of cardiovascular occasions,” the researchers wrote.

Coronary heart Protections Are Probably Reversed for a Few Causes

GLP-1 drugs can assist coronary heart well being in a number of alternative ways. “They work by a mixture of many occasions, together with weight reduction and enhancing insulin sensitivity,” says Cheng-Han Chen, MD, an interventional heart specialist and the medical director of the structural coronary heart program at MemorialCare Saddleback Medical Middle in Laguna Hills, California. “That results in advantages in levels of cholesterol, lowered bodily irritation, and different mechanisms that assist with coronary heart well being.”

Dr. Chen says it is sensible that these advantages would disappear if somebody stops taking the medicine, particularly within the absence of dietary and way of life modifications that assist coronary heart well being.

Al-Aly says this reversal could also be tied to weight regain, however there’s probably extra to it than that. “We’re calling it a ‘metabolic reversal,’” he says. “You already acquired your physique used to much less insulin resistance, decrease blood strain, and decrease ldl cholesterol. Once you cease the medicine, you expertise that whiplash, which stresses the guts.”

When somebody stops taking a GLP-1, levels of cholesterol and markers of bodily irritation can spike, Al-Aly says — and that may be laborious on the cardiovascular system.

Going On and Off GLP-1s Can Scale back Potential Coronary heart Well being Advantages

Individuals who stopped and restarted a GLP didn’t find yourself getting again to the extent of coronary heart safety achieved by individuals who took the medicine persistently. The precise cause for this isn’t clear.

“It’s doable that the research wasn’t lengthy sufficient to indicate all of the useful results over time,” Chen says.

However Al-Aly says there could also be extra to it. “What we noticed is that it takes folks numerous time to construct cardiovascular safety and half the time to undo it,” he says. “What takes folks a 12 months to construct could be undone inside half a 12 months of stopping.”

It’s additionally doable that the results of happening and off a GLP-1 are too laborious for the physique to maneuver previous, says Mir Ali, MD, the medical director of MemorialCare Surgical Weight Loss Middle at Orange Coast Medical Middle in Fountain Valley, California. “Once you get harm attributable to irritation that may consequence from going off these drugs, it may be more durable to beat,” he says.

What This Means for GLP-1 Customers

Individuals usually go on and off GLP-1 medicine due to value and lack of insurance coverage protection. “Lots of people get enthusiastic about utilizing these photographs, however some folks should dish out $400 a month to maintain up. That’s a automotive fee,” Al-Aly says.

Al-Aly stresses the significance of speaking with a healthcare supplier about your objectives and the power to keep up these drugs when you begin them. “These drugs will not be actually meant for the brief time period,” he says. “If folks begin on a journey after which cease, they may find yourself in a worse place.”

For those who’ve already began taking a GLP-1 and may’t proceed with it, Al-Aly recommends speaking together with your healthcare supplier about choices. “You could possibly probably de-escalate and go to a smaller upkeep dose. These are sometimes cheaper,” he says. “However the proof exhibits {that a} full stoppage will undo numerous the advantages you accrued over time.”

Ali additionally factors out that new drugs are coming, too. “We’re hoping these might be cheaper, however that is still to be seen,” he says.
